The authorities and the opposition in Belarus are creating security forces on the eve of October 25, the expiration date of the “ultimatum” put forward to the country’s President Alexander Lukashenko by the self-proclaimed “national leader” Svetlana Tikhanovskaya, who is in Lithuania.

The opposition media have turned on the ominous counter and every day they warn how much is left until the 25th. The “Belarusian Guaido” herself decided today to aggravate the ultimatum and addressed the security forces with another call to “come over to the side of the people.”

“The regime knows that it is dying - and is trying to share its fate with all of you, sullying the honor of your uniform. Don't let this happen. Those who committed crimes will bear personal responsibility. There will be no blanket lustration. In the new Belarus, your work is needed, a system of law enforcement agencies is needed. Therefore, contact us, the funds, make a public appeal with the support of your people,” Tikhanovskaya appeals on her Telegram channel.

This is not the first appeal to the security forces from the opposition, and so far these exhortations have not been successful. And of course, it is absolutely incredible that the owner of a machine gun and a bulletproof vest, Alexander Lukashenko, will suddenly fulfill the ultimatum of the Polish-Lithuanian puppet Tikhanovskaya and voluntarily abdicate power.

What does the opposition hope for? In the “ultimatum,” Tikhanovskaya threatened a “national strike.” But the protests in Belarus have long entered the routine phase of regular marches with a tendency to slowly fade away. The security forces are no longer trying very hard to disperse them.

However, in addition to official opposition calls for peaceful protests, groups have appeared on the Internet organizing forceful resistance to the regime.

As anarchist Nikolai Dziadok writes in his Telegram channel, on September 9, a channel with the loud name “Civil Self-Defense Units of Belarus” (OGSB) appeared on Telegram, where the “peace-loving” Polish network of channels coordinating weekly marches is actively criticized, and volunteers are recruited.

The channel cultivates the idea of ​​“Day X,” on which supposedly “everything will be decided” in the “Minsk cauldron for the Lukashenko regime.” The OGSB is trying to unite groups of radicals into one “combat-ready organization.”

Dedok himself opposed this idea. He believes that the activities of the OGSB “will not lead to anything other than the emergence of new political prisoners.”

“My heart really hurts for the young guys and girls who, in their ardor, will go where they shouldn’t, and expose themselves to deadlines, without even having time to really do anything. The main thing I wanted to say is that self-defense units in their classic form are only possible where the state has disappeared or weakened. In our situation, when the state exists and maximizes its punitive function,” Dedok wrote.

At the same time, the Belarusian police are also recruiting volunteers. The state television channel ONT announced the formation of people's squads to protect law and order. Volunteers are incentivized with time off and financial payments. For now they are on duty from 18 to 22 pm, but it is quite possible that they will find themselves on the streets during the day, for example, on October 25, when Tikhanovskaya’s ultimatum expires.

The clash between the OGSB and the people's squads will mark the beginning of a real civil war, and not clashes between the opposition and the state represented by the police, as has been the case until now.
As for the Belarusian Ministry of Internal Affairs directly, the rhetoric of the local leadership is becoming more and more radical. After promises to use military weapons against the protesters, the head of the department for combating organized crime, Nikolai Karpenkov, called them bandits.

“Bandits who burn cars and tires, attack law enforcement officers with sharps and tear gas, and threaten with violence the families of those who disagree with their rules of the game - have nothing to do with peaceful civil protest. And it is dangerous for ordinary citizens to be in such proximity at rallies. It is their radicals, often united in organized criminal groups, who use them as human shields,” Karpenkov said on the Belarus-1 TV channel.

Let us recall that the chairman of the Belarusian KGB, Ivan Tertel, warned in advance about the bloody provocation being prepared by the opposition and declared his readiness to prevent it. Will this provocation take place on the 25th?
